Background
IFN-omega is a type I interferon, which can be induced by virus-infected leukocytes. Members of the type I interferon family, which includes IFN-a, IFN-B, and IFN-w, signal through IFNAR-1/IFNAR-2 receptor complex, and exert anti-viral and anti-proliferative activities. IFN-omega exhibits about 75% sequence homology with IFN-a, and contains two conserved disulfide bonds, which are necessary for full biological activity. Recombinant Human IFN-omega is a 19.9 kDa protein consisting of 172 amino acid residues.

Storage Conditions
The lyophilized IFN-omega recombinant protein is stable for at least 2 years from date of receipt at -20˚ C. Reconstituted IFN-omega is stable for at least 3 months when stored in working aliquots with a carrier protein at -20˚ C. As with any protein, exposing IFN-omega recombinant protein to repeated freeze / thaw cycles is not recommended. When working with proteins care should be taken to keep recombinant protein at a cool and stable temperature.
